Yes I've seen others have this problem, as far as I know the only solution that worked was to wait. They tried creating a new Mi account to use for unlocking, but I guess the unlock server validation recognised they was trying to get around the wait period and it still give them the same long wait time on the new account.
I believe this happens if Xiaomi believe you are a reseller installing unofficial ROMs. Have you unlocked many phones recently, within the last couple of months or so? For some reason their algorithm that determines these things must have flagged your account.

Hi Yes.
With me already happened on 2 devices, I waited for the initial time for the unlock and with a few hours left to finish the time I tried and received a new time count (average of 50% of the initial time).
I logged into the device with another xiaomi account and logged out, just this. I logged back in with the initial unlock request account and then tried the unlock and it worked.
I imagine that signing in with another account should start some synchronization process between the device and the account and with that update ....
PS. Be careful, and use only a trusted xiaomi account, as in the event of an error, your device may get stuck with bootloader locked in an unknown account.
